squadron [ˈskwɒdrən] n 1. (Military) a. a subdivision of a naval fleet detached for a particular task b. a number of naval units usually of similar type and consisting of two or more divisions 2. (Military) a cavalry unit comprising two or more troops, headquarters, and supporting arms 3. (Military) the basic tactical and administrative air force unit comprising two or more flights Abbreviation sqn [from Italian squadrone soldiers drawn up in square formation, from squadro square] Squadron any body of men in a regular formation; a division of a fleet or air force; a force of 150 to 200 men in the army. Examples: squadron of air craft—Brewer; of angels; of bees, 1713; of cardinals, 1906; of clouds, 1862; of consideration, 1680; of dissent, 1824; of galleons, 1588; of the Fathers, 1617; of blessed spirits, 1684; of ships; of soldiers, 1656. squadron - Borrowed from Italian squadrone, from Latin quadrare, "square"; the sense of "military group" comes from an earlier "square formation of troops." See also related terms for troops. 1. An organization consisting of two or more divisions of ships, or two or more divisions (Navy) or flights of aircraft. It is normally but not necessarily composed of ships or aircraft of the same type. 2. The basic administrative aviation unit of the Army, Navy, Marine Corps, and Air Force. 3. Battalion-sized ground or aviation units in US Army cavalry regiments. ThesaurusLegend: Synonyms Related Words Antonyms
